The indefinite integral of cosecant squared of angle … WebMar 15, 2015 · Go through the list: d dx (sinx) = cosx d dx (cosx) = −sinx d dx (tanx) = sec2x Hang on! that's good! The derivative if a co function has a minus sign and cofunctions, so d dx (cotx) = −csc2x So, no, I don't know a function whose derivative is csc2x, but I do know one whose derivative is −csc2c.
